Train fire fighters and avoid injuries and fatalities during live fire training with the 2012 NFPA 1403: Standard on Live Fire Training Evolutions.

Critical to safety during fire fighter training exercises, NFPA 1403 compliance can dramatically decrease the likelihood of fire fighter injuries and deaths.

This reorganized 2012 edition of the Standard contains important updates that further protect fire fighters with clear, easy-to-follow guidance:
  • New Chapter 4 addresses general items to which all live fire training evolutions must adhere for safety.
  • Clarified items include requirements for Emergency Medical Services, allowable types of Class A products, instructor duties, and the role of the fire control team.
  • A new requirement mandates that each burn room have a burn plan in place to limit building damage and fire fighter injuries.
  • Revised inspection and maintenance requirements for live fire training structures are also included.
